The AirTAC GFR30015JC3T AirTAC Filter Regulator NPT1/2 is a genuine G-series filter regulator: water separation, 40 µm particulate filtration and balanced-type pressure regulation combined in a single body. It has PT1/2" ports, a differential-pressure drain and regulates 0.15 - 0.9 MPa (20 - 130 psi). It does not lubricate — add a GL lubricator, or order the GFC two-unit set, if downstream equipment needs oil.
The AirTAC GFR30015JC3T is a 300-size filter regulator that removes water and particulate from compressed air and sets downstream pressure in a single body. This configuration carries a 1/2 in NPT port, the standard 40 um filter element, and a differential-pressure drain that bleeds collected condensate automatically whenever the pressure differential across the element is high enough, so no manual draining routine is needed. Pressure is set with the fitted round gauge reading in bar, the regulator is the standard (non low-pressure) type, no reverse/check valve is fitted, and the unit is supplied without a mounting bracket.
This is a genuine AirTAC part from the GFR series, which spans sizes 200, 300, 400 and 600 with port sizes from 1/8 in to 1 in, optional 5 um filtration (code W), automatic or manual drains, gauge and scale choices, and G/NPT thread options. The regulating band is set by the drain type: automatic and differential-pressure drains regulate 0.15 - 0.9 MPa, a manual drain regulates 0.05 - 0.9 MPa. Standard type, regulating 0.15 - 0.9 MPa (20 - 130 psi). Air must not freeze in the unit. | GFR300 | G-series filter regulator, 300 body — sets the port range. |
|---|---|
| 15 | Port size PT1/2". This body offers 08 = PT1/4", 10 = PT3/8", 15 = PT1/2". |
| (blank) | Drain: Differential-pressure drain — this also sets the regulating band (0.15 - 0.9 MPa (20 - 130 psi)). |
| (blank) | Standard type. Blank is standard, L is the low-pressure type. |
| J | Supplied without bracket. |
| (blank) | Pressure gauge fitted (blank). |
| C | Gauge shape: Round. C is round, F is square. |
| 3 | Gauge scale: bar. 1 is MPa, 2 is psi, 3 is bar. |
| (blank) | Filtering grade 40 µm. Only 40 µm (blank) and 5 µm (W) exist. |
| T | NPT thread. PT is the default; G is BSPP and T is NPT. |
| (blank) | No reverse-flow valve (the default). |
Field order is size, port, drain, type, bracket, gauge, shape, scale, grade, thread, reflux — a blank position takes the default. Example: GFR300-08 is a 300 body, PT1/4", differential drain, standard type, bracket included, gauge fitted, 40 µm, PT thread, no reflux valve.
A larger body carries a larger port and holds set pressure better as flow rises. AirTAC publishes flow only as curves, so size the body from your peak demand with headroom. The GFR600 uses an aluminium-alloy bowl; the 200, 300 and 400 bodies use PC.

Filtered, regulated air for the tool-changer and clamping circuits on a CNC machining center, with the 1/2 in NPT port feeding the cell's main air drop and the bar gauge giving operators a visible setpoint.
Clean, pressure-set air for the pick-and-place cylinders and diverters on a carton packaging line, where the differential-pressure drain keeps condensate off the valves without a daily bowl-draining task.
A filter-regulator point at the take-off from a factory ring main, conditioning supply for downstream air tools and actuators while the 40 um element catches pipe scale and rust from the distribution piping.

The 40 um element suits general plant air; specify the W code if you need 5 um. The differential-pressure drain on this model is the fit-and-forget choice; automatic (A) or manual (M) drains are available in the family if your maintenance routine prefers them. The round gauge here reads in bar; MPa and psi scales and the embedded square gauge are the other catalogue choices. Thread: PT is the AirTAC standard and this code specifies NPT; G (BSPP) is the other order option. A mounting bracket (J = none) can be added if you want the unit secured to a panel or wall.

The PC bowl must not be cleaned with solvents — wipe it with a dry cloth. Without the K option, air cannot flow back through the unit. A filter regulator adds no oil to the line.
